Abstract

An information messaging and collaboration system is described. In one embodiment, for example, a method is described for interactive content retrieval and display, the method comprises steps of: providing a plurality of portlets for retrieval of content for display in a user interface; mapping a message action to a first portlet to create a messaging portlet for sending a message in response to user interaction with the messaging portlet; creating a listener portlet by registering a second portlet to receive messages from the messaging portlet; and in response to user interaction with the messaging portlet, retrieving particular content for display in the user interface based on the message received by the listener portlet from the messaging portlet.

1 . A method for interactive content retrieval and display, the method comprising: 
 providing a plurality of portlets for retrieval of content for display in a user interface;    mapping a message action to a first portlet to create a messaging portlet for sending a message in response to user interaction with the messaging portlet;    creating a listener portlet by registering a second portlet to receive messages from the messaging portlet; and    in response to user interaction with the messaging portlet, retrieving particular content for display in the user interface based on the message received by the listener portlet from the messaging portlet.

       22 . A system for interactive content retrieval and display, the system comprising: 
 a user interface for display of content;    an actioner module for display of content in the user interface and sending a message based on user interaction with said actioner module;    a registrar for receiving the message from said actioner module and routing the message to at least one listener module registered to receive the message; and    at least one listener module registered for receiving the message from the registrar and retrieving content for display in the user interface based on the message sent by the actioner module.
